Living solo in an RV in Arizona offers a special blend of freedom and creativity that many might not expect. From my experience, transforming a small living space into both a home and an art studio encourages innovation in ways that a traditional home might not. The limited space means every item must have a purpose, leading to a curated environment that boosts focus and artistic exploration. Arizona’s stunning landscapes provide daily inspiration. Whether it’s the desert’s warm hues at sunset or the expansive skies, the environment feeds my creative process. Being mobile allows me to follow the light and weather conditions ideal for creating different pieces, which has enriched my artistic style. Single-person living also fosters deep self-awareness and discipline. Without distractions, I can immerse myself fully in my art, experimenting with different mediums and techniques. This solitude is a source of strength, fostering an authentic personal style that resonates with my experiences and surroundings. For anyone considering this lifestyle, I recommend investing in multifunctional furnishings to maximize space and creating a dedicated art nook that feels both cozy and practical. Embrace the unpredictability of life on the road; it adds originality and storytelling to your artwork that can’t be replicated in a traditional setting. Overall, living and creating art in an RV in Arizona is more than a lifestyle—it’s an empowering journey of self-discovery and artistic expression that offers endless possibilities despite the compact living space.
